I received a gift card for a big service which I booked on their website. The home pickup and delivery option was a huge plus, especially since I live quite far from either of their workshops.
The day after pickup, I was contacted and told that both the bike chain and a gear on the rear wheel needed replacement. I was a bit taken aback by the price of the chain and was hesitant, but was repeatedly told—rather bluntly—that it had to be done. I eventually agreed, assuming that Ren Cykel’s premium pricing reflected the use of premium parts.
However, when I received the invoice, I saw a charge of 499 kr for a PC1 chain — a part that typically costs 79–99 kr. That’s a hefty markup, especially considering it’s a basic snaplock chain that doesn’t require a lengthy installation. Still, since I had already agreed, I didn’t complain.
I then received two invoices without the gift card deducted. I called about this, being told this would promptly be corrected. After waiting with no update, I followed up — only to find the phone lines closed for the weekend.
My bike was returned regardless, which was a relief — but unfortunately, it came back with black smudges on my beige luggage strap on the front carrier. I hadn’t expected a clean bike, but I certainly didn’t expect it to come back dirtier than when I sent it off.
To top it all off, I received a payment reminder by text on Monday morning, threatening late fees if I didn’t pay that same day — even though I still hadn’t received a corrected invoice. After another call, I finally got the right one. No apology or acknowledgment of the error.
All in all, I am quite disappointed with how this went and cannot recommend them for either service or part replacement.
